About the Role

Lockheed Martin Space is seeking a full-time Software Engineer to support the software engineering lifecycle in a space domain context. The role involves working on innovative space solutions, supporting requirements analysis, design, coding, testing, and integration, with a focus on resiliency and security. The company emphasizes fostering innovation, reducing costs, and advancing space technology through partnerships and workforce development. This position requires special access and a Final Secret government security clearance, and is located at a designated Lockheed Martin facility.

Key Responsibilities

  • Support the software engineering lifecycle following the program Software Development Plan (SDP).
  • Perform requirements analysis, object-oriented analysis & design, coding, and unit testing.
  • Assist with integration, formal testing, and delivery of software products.
  • Design and develop software using languages such as C or C++.
  • Work on embedded software/hardware systems.
  • Participate in full software life cycle development including software design, architecture, and testing.

Requirements

  • Experience with programming languages such as C, C++.
  • Experience or classroom knowledge with embedded software/hardware.
  • Bachelor's degree in computer science, Aerospace Engineering, or related field from an accredited college/university.
  • Active/Final Secret Security Clearance.
  • Must be a US Citizen.
